After playing the demo for a couple days, I'm pretty damn impressed.

To me, it feels like a slower, more methodical Left 4 Dead with a hell of a lot more upgrade options. Even after tackling the same level a dozen times or more, it's still a challenge each runthrough, which is probably my favorite aspect. The weapons feel meaty and powerful, and apparently Starbreeze is using the same sound design as heard in Battlefield 3.

My main gripe is that I don't think many players realize that healing your teammates is the key to victory, as I've been in a down-but-not-out state while my squad ignore me more than a handful of times.

I had no interest or any real knowledge of this game before the demo, but it's now on my must-buy list. I'd figured it was going to be another by the numbers shooter. Highly recommended if you're looking for a FPS with a few cool twists.

Yeah, at least from the level I played. I think there is a singleplayer campaign, too.

There are a few miniboss-like sergeants sprinkled throughout the level, which have extra shields and pursue you and your team more aggressively. At the end of the stage you have to beat a guy equipped with a minigun. What makes it fun though is trying to distract him while your team hacks his shields, or vice versa. Makes for some very dynamic, challenging gameplay.
